About

Greenacre International School is an inclusive international school located on Koh Samui, Thailand, offering education from Early Years through Key Stage 3 based on the English National Curriculum. The school emphasises holistic development, environmental awareness, and cultural sensitivity towards Thai values and traditions. It provides a nurturing environment focused on academic learning, co-curricular opportunities, and responsible citizenship.

Why Families Choose

Greenacre is set on a 7.5-rai natural campus in southern Koh Samui surrounded by lush greenery and close to waterfalls, integrating outdoor classrooms and environmental awareness into daily teaching. It is a certified Pearson Edexcel Examinations Centre delivering the English National Curriculum from age 3 to 16, with a strong emphasis on sustainability, compassion, and learning in nature.

Admissions Process

  1. 1Book a visit — staff explain the admissions procedure, required documents, payments, and next steps; EAL students meet the EAL specialist. 2. Prepare and submit documents — Greenacre Application Form, recent school reports, birth certificate/Thai ID, two passport photos, and passport copies for parents and child. 3. Offer, acceptance, and payments — acceptance must be completed before the first day; paying the school fees and the non-refundable registration fee constitutes formal acceptance of a place.

School Day

The school day begins with a flag ceremony at 8:40 am, followed by lessons starting shortly afterwards. Students have a morning break from 10:30–10:45 and a lunch break from 12:00–12:45 in Primary or 12:15–1:00 in Secondary. Afternoon lessons continue until 3:00 pm, with clubs running from 3:00–3:45 on most days.

Student Life

Uniform

The school shop sells the full uniform. Uniforms are lightweight cotton shirts with a green gingham-check pattern and charcoal grey skirt or shorts. Sportswear uses breathable micro fabrics. Main uniform sets cost 700–850 Baht; sportswear sets cost 400–450 Baht.

Food & Dining

A daily lunch is offered at 50 Baht per child per day. There is a large dining hall adjacent to the main site with an attached kitchen for meals and snacks. Primary and secondary students are served in two sittings; early years eat within the nursery building. Vegetarian and vegan options are available daily. Packed lunches are allowed.
